Houston has really grown into a bike city. I lead a few rides in town and after being told that there needed to be "A Morrissey Ride" I decided to made it happen, again. The first one was postponed due to the weather 3 times in 2013.

All the elements in the video were planned. I had the route in place and had 2 friends filming and asked both to be at certain locations at certain times.

My only regret is that more riders weren't featured in the footage. There were a few Smiths and Morrissey shirts in the mix along with jean jackets, glasses and cardigans. The ride actually ended at a Boz Boorer gig. (The ride was planned before the gig was booked.)

The building used as the SLC had been in my radar for years. Many thnx.
